QSE Index Opens Lower

Economy

  • A-
  • A
  • A+
استمع
news

Doha, March 30 (QNA) - The Qatar Stock Exchange (QSE) general index declined by 58.71 points, or 0.58%, at the start of trading on Monday, falling to 10001 points from the previous session's close, under pressure from all sectors.

The market was weighed down by Real Estate (-0.27%), Banks and Financial Services (-0.29%), Transportation (-0.68%), Insurance (-0.74%), Industrials (-0.83%), Consumer Goods and Services by (-0.97 %), and Telecoms (-1.80%).

By 10:00 am, trading turnover reached QAR 82.487 million, with 30.071 million shares traded across 4459 transactions. (QNA)
